2026 is not a normal Gemini year. Uranus, the planet of revolution and surprise, enters your sign for the first time in 84 years and stays through 2033. This once-in-a-lifetime transit shakes up your identity, direction, and how you show up in the world. Think of it as a seven-year personal renovation — messy, exciting, and full of unexpected discoveries. Here's what that actually means, month by month, so you can ride the wave instead of getting knocked over.

Gemini 2026 at a Glance

The biggest astrological news for you is Uranus in Gemini, starting April 18. For the first time since 1945, the rebel planet lights up your sign, pushing you to break free from old patterns and reinvent yourself. This isn't a subtle nudge — it's a cosmic shake-up that can feel like a midlife crisis or a sudden breakthrough, depending on how you lean into change.

Supporting this headline: two solar eclipses in Gemini (May 30 and December 14) and a lunar eclipse in Sagittarius on June 15 that spotlight your relationships. Mercury, your ruler, goes retrograde three times in 2026 — all in fire signs, which means communication hiccups hit your ego and self-expression hard. Quarter-by-Quarter Highlights

  • Q1 (Jan–Mar): Pre-Uranus calm. Mars in Gemini until Feb 13 gives you a burst of energy to tie up loose ends. Use this time to get organized — once Uranus hits, your schedule will change.
  • Q2 (Apr–Jun): Uranus enters Gemini April 18. Immediate shake-ups in your daily routine, appearance, or self-image. The Gemini solar eclipse on May 30 amplifies this — expect a sudden pivot in your personal path.
  • Q3 (Jul–Sep): Uranus retrograde (Aug 7–Jan 27, 2027) slows the pace. You'll revisit changes you made earlier and decide what sticks. A second Mercury retrograde in Virgo (Sep 24–Oct 16) tests your work and health routines.
  • Q4 (Oct–Dec): Uranus direct again in late January but the energy builds through December. The Gemini solar eclipse on December 14 closes the year with another identity nudge. You'll enter 2027 as a noticeably different person.

Gemini Love Horoscope 2026

Uranus in your sign doesn't just change your hairstyle — it shakes up who you love and how. You may outgrow a relationship that once felt perfect. Or you might suddenly find yourself attracted to someone completely outside your type (think: a polar opposite, someone from a different culture, or an age gap that raises eyebrows). The key is honesty — with yourself and your partner.

For committed Geminis: this year will test your bond. Uranus asks, "Is this relationship still helping you grow?" If you've been feeling stuck or pretending things are fine, the truth will surface. A lunar eclipse on June 15 in Sagittarius (your opposite sign) could trigger a major conversation about freedom vs. commitment. Couples who adapt — trying new activities, giving each other breathing room, shaking up the routine — can come out stronger.

Single Geminis: you're magnetic in 2026, but the people you attract may be unpredictable. Think the artist who just moved to town, the person you meet at a protest, or a friend who suddenly sees you differently. The May 30 solar eclipse is a powerful window to meet someone new, especially through a class, workshop, or online community. Gemini Career and Money Horoscope 2026

This is a pivot year for your professional life. Uranus in Gemini encourages experimentation — think side hustles, freelance gigs, or a complete career change. The 9-to-5 grind might feel suffocating; you'll crave variety and intellectual stimulation. If you've been dreaming of starting a podcast, launching a blog, or turning your hobby into income, 2026 is the year to try it.

Money-wise, expect ups and downs. Some months you'll land a lucrative project; others, your budget will need belt-tightening. The best strategy: keep a stable income source (even part-time) while you experiment with new streams. Jupiter in Cancer until early June supports real estate, family businesses, or anything related to home and emotional security. After that, Jupiter moves to Leo and boosts your creative and romantic ventures.

Best months to launch a big project: May (especially around the solar eclipse), September (after Mercury retrograde ends on Oct 16), and late December (post-eclipse energy). Avoid starting anything major during any Mercury retrograde window — your ruler's retrogrades can cause miscommunication and technical glitches.

Mercury Retrograde 2026 for Gemini

Because Mercury rules you, its retrograde periods hit you harder than other signs. You'll feel the slowdown in communication, travel, and tech — double-check your texts, back up your phone, and don't sign contracts until the retrograde is over. But these retrogrades are also opportunities to review, rethink, and reconnect.

Here are the 2026 retrograde windows:

  • Jan 30–Feb 20: In Aquarius — shake-ups in friendships and group projects. Old friends may reappear.
  • May 29–Jun 22: In Gemini — this one is intense. Your identity, self-expression, and personal direction go into review. Perfect for journaling and therapy.
  • Sep 24–Oct 16: In Virgo — work, health, and daily routines need recalibration. Avoid major health-panel decisions until after.

How To Work With Uranus in Gemini

Uranus is a disruptive force, but you can ride it instead of fighting it. The key: experiment before you're forced to. If you feel a restlessness building, channel it into something creative — start a new hobby, take a solo trip, change your look. The goal is to initiate change on your terms, rather than waiting for Uranus to yank the rug.

Keep what survives the shake-up. Not every change will stick — some experiments will fizzle, and that's fine. By the end of 2026, you'll have a clearer sense of what truly fits your authentic self. The pieces that remain are keepers.

Grounding practices are essential for an electric year. Uranus energy can make you jittery and prone to impulse. A daily meditation or a walk in nature (no phone) helps. Crystals like black tourmaline or smoky quartz can absorb excess energy. And when in doubt, ask yourself: "Does this choice expand me, or is it just chaos?"
